Badfish 10-29-2005 09:04 PM

hmmmm how much was paint Blake? and how hard was drilling?

WaterDR 10-30-2005 06:11 AM

I got my hood painted, front bumper painted, and wing painted for $150. I am the wrong one to ask. I had a friend do it and I just gave him money for paint.

But, I have heard a wing alone runs about $100 - $150. The website that I bought the wing from will ship them to you painted. I will have to locate the site if you are interested.

The holes are really no problem. Just make sure you put them in the right place. The prblem is making the holes large enough on the underside in order to get the bolt on. But nothing you can't do w/o the right drill bits. You also have to spend some extra time to make it look neat from the under side. I really did not do that, but filled in the holes with some black electrical tape. I have a black car, so you don't see it and it is under the lid anyway.
